![]() For a multi-project workspace, additional projects in the projects folder contain a project-name/src/ subfolder with the same structure. relativePosition: number: Position of the target page in the history relative to the current page. Component templates are not always fixed. You can find these and much more information in our upcoming post about "Angular: The learning path". For each view we need different UI components. This gives Angular an optimized lighter core. ![]() Angular provides a separate module, RouterModule to set up the navigation in the Angular application. The scenario we've just described has a lot to do with the Separation of Concerns principle. It's fully extensible and works very well with other libraries. Get these right now if they're not installed on your computer. This is an awesome responsive bootstrap carousel with multiple items. An example of data being processed may be a unique identifier stored in a cookie. Angular is a platform for building mobile and desktop web applications. A modular approach such as this, makes our app's business logic reusable. We will learn enough core Angular to get started and gain confidence that we can build any kind of app with Angular. Optimizations to the build process that reduces the application size by removing unnecessary code. A component controls one or more sections on the screen called a view. In the project root we have three important folders and some important files: Inside of the /src directory we find our raw, uncompiled code. get(name) Returns the value of the specified name in the path (parameter list). pipes, and components into one module and then import just that module wherever you need it in other parts of your application. ![]() When router-outlet is used in a component other then root component, the routes for the particular component has to be configured as the children of the parent component. get() method returns only the first value when multiple values are available. This bootstrap thumbnail slider displays images/articles one by one and is responsive. Reactive forms use an explicit and Angular is a platform for building mobile and desktop web applications. It can also be wrapped with content that you want to be in every page (for example a toolbar). When the migration is complete, you will access your Teams at, and they will no longer appear in the left sidebar on. Templates are used to define a component view. Here you will find all the variables, mixins, shared styles, etc, that will make your app customizable and extendable. This version of the library (2.5.0) works only with Bootstrap CSS in version 3.x. Minimize the need to integrate multiple UI libraries. This makes going from a basic app to a full featured navigation web app much easier. Route path is similar to web page URL and it supports relative path as well. The key to an evolving app is to create reusable services to manage all the data calls to your backend. What is a Compilation Context in Angular? Material Design components with server-side rendering. The and files are siblings in the same folder. What am I missing? In the next tutorial we will explore how to add a backend for this Angular app, using the MEAN stack. You can get more details about this multiple item carousel design from the below link. Another common use case for attribute binding is with the colspan attribute in tables. ![]() navigate function expects an array with necessary path information. Well, this concept is called Dependency Injection and it is super important to know more about this. Binding to the colspan attribute helps you to keep your tables For example, to update from version 10 to version 12: Update from version 10 to version 11. ![]() There is no actual risk in this application because the lifetime of a AstronautComponent is the same as the lifetime of the application itself. Include router-outlet tag in the root component template. Step 3: Include a theme: To allow customization and theming, ng-select bundle includes only generic styles that are necessary for correct layout and positioning. This module collects directives that either imported from another module(if transitive module of imported module has exported directives) or declared in current module. Here, we have added Go to List button before Edit button. Update AppRoutingModule (src/app/) as mentioned below. Binding to the colspan attribute helps you to keep your tables Templates can also include custom components like in the form of non-regular html tags. One big and great approach is to load the module from a NgModuleFactory, you can load a module inside another module by calling this: SOLVED HOW TO USE A COMPONENT DECLARED IN A MODULE IN OTHER MODULE.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|